Originally published in 1917, 'The Status of the Negro in Virginia During the Colonial Period' was one of the first books to explore the social and economic conditions faced by African Americans in colonial Virginia. Drawing on a wide range of sources, including court records and personal accounts, Gerald Montgomery West provides a nuanced and insightful analysis of this complex historical period.
